faecher:informatik:oberstufe:datenbanken:projekt:java_db:java_db_p_adressbuch:start

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en der Seite angezeigt.

Link zu der Vergleichsansicht

Beide Seiten, vorherige Überarbeitung Vorherige Überarbeitung
faecher:informatik:oberstufe:datenbanken:projekt:java_db:java_db_p_adressbuch:start [03.04.2025 19:58] Frank Schiebelfaecher:informatik:oberstufe:datenbanken:projekt:java_db:java_db_p_adressbuch:start [03.04.2025 20:00] (aktuell) Frank Schiebel
Zeile 9: Zeile 9:
 Passe zunächst die Methode ''connect()'' der Klasse ''AdressbuchController'' so an, dass die Verbindung zur Datenbank hergestellt werden kann. Passe zunächst die Methode ''connect()'' der Klasse ''AdressbuchController'' so an, dass die Verbindung zur Datenbank hergestellt werden kann.
  
 +Deine Aufgabe ist, das Auslesen, Anlegen, Verändern und Löschen von Einträgen in der Klasse ''Adressbucheintrag'' zu implementieren (Methoden ''getAlleAdressen'', ''speichern'' und ''loeschen'').
  
 +Zur Sicherheit sollten die Text- und Datumseingaben grundsätzlich in Prepared Statements über Parameter an die Datenbank übermittelt werden.
 +
 +Zur Erinnerung:
 +
 +<code java>
 +PreparedStatement ps = 
 +         conn.prepareStatement("UPDATE mytable SET text = ?");
 +ps.setString(1, "fritz");
 +ps.execute();
 +</code>
  • faecher/informatik/oberstufe/datenbanken/projekt/java_db/java_db_p_adressbuch/start.1743710336.txt.gz
  • Zuletzt geändert: 03.04.2025 19:58
  • von Frank Schiebel